To celebrate National Day, the City of Geneva invites its residents to join a large community festival at La Grange Park. A wide range of activities will be on offer, combining traditional entertainment, children’s games, local and international cuisine, concerts, and DJs. A large, affordable brunch will offer a chance to discover local specialties. Federal Councilor Beat Jans will be the guest of honor for the day. The poster for this year’s event was designed by Geneva-based artist Albertine.
August 1 in the City of Geneva will be dedicated to the concept of “shared time.” The day will begin with a delicious local brunch (from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m.) at Eaux-Vives Park, bringing together 500 guests and organized in collaboration with Genève Terroir. In case of rain, it will be moved to the Plainpalais community hall.
This is an opportunity to bring city dwellers closer to the countryside by offering them the chance to discover a wide range of local products and to highlight the work of the canton’s farmers.
